Ticket: Staging env misconfigured for Siftgate bloom filter

The bloom layer in front of the Pellet KV store is rejecting all lookups in staging because the env file was copied from the dev template without credentials. False-positive tuning values are fine; only the auth line is missing. To unblock the weekly demo, the Pellet admission secret must be set on the following line.

env line for yaguf-fajop: LEDGER_TOKEN13=fb08984397349

## Limits & Quotas: Spreadsheet Export Memory

Heads up, plugin folks: the Gridwhale export engine buffers whole sheets in memory before streaming, so a big export from your plugin can blow past the sandbox cap fast. We cap row batches and cell-string pools per export job, and anything beyond that gets spilled to temp storage (slow!). If your plugin generates exports, keep batch sizes under the defaults. The current tuning constants for export memory are listed below.

tuning table, faduf-baduf:
PRIORITIES = {
    "ulavan": 191,
    "silys": 750,
    "goriel": 238,
    "kelmir": 66,
    "wendor": 432,
}

Hi Maren,

Handing over the Brindlecore release duties. The connection pooler config now lives in the `poolctl` repo; max connections are tuned per replica, so don't copy values between environments. Staging pool metrics are on the Larkspur dashboard. Deploys to the pooler require a signed bundle, and the deploy key you'll need is below.

signing key of bagap-yawep = bky13_TbfT6ZMUoGJo2

Handover note — Crumbwheel order cutoffs.

Welcome aboard. The bakery cutoff rule in Crumbwheel closes same-day orders at 14:00 local to each storefront, not UTC — this has bitten us twice. Holiday overrides live in the calendar service and take precedence silently, so always check there first when a cutoff looks wrong. To unlock the calendar service's admin console after a restart, enter the recovery passphrase below.

vault phrase of bagap-bahaf = silion-pelox-sorox-casdor-quenwyn-fraax-eliox-praael-kelion-quenvan-kasox-rusael-norius-belvan